© Joy Ventura 12 2025
All rights reserved.

.

test

Price upon request
    -
    +

    Sign In to see your saved Addresses

    Check availability of product in your area

    test

    Afghanistan

    In Stock

    273632-a68e179c

    Customer reviews

    0 Reviews

    Please login to write a review Log In

    Start typing and press Enter to search